Key Skills for Marketing Strategy Careers

To thrive in marketing strategy careers, especially in California, certain skills are essential. I’ve compiled a list of key skills that can help you stand out in this competitive field.

1. **Analytical Thinking**: Being able to analyze data and draw actionable insights is crucial. This skill allows you to assess the performance of marketing campaigns and make necessary adjustments.

2. **Creativity**: Innovative thinking is at the heart of impactful marketing strategies. I’ve seen how creative campaigns can resonate with audiences and drive engagement.

3. **Digital Proficiency**: In today’s digital age, understanding various digital marketing tools and platforms is non-negotiable. Familiarity with SEO, social media, and content marketing can give you a significant edge.

4. **Communication Skills**: Whether it’s crafting a compelling brand story or collaborating with team members, strong communication is vital in marketing strategy careers. I’ve found that clear communication can turn a good idea into a great one.

5. **Project Management**: Being organized and able to manage multiple projects is essential in this field. Marketing campaigns often require coordination between various teams, and effective project management ensures everything runs smoothly.

Remote Opportunities in Marketing Strategy

The rise of remote work has transformed the landscape for marketing strategy careers. I’ve noticed that many companies in California are now open to hiring remote marketers, broadening the pool of opportunities. This flexibility allows you to work with companies outside your immediate geographic area, expanding your reach.

I recommend exploring job boards that specialize in remote work. Websites such as Remote.co and We Work Remotely often list marketing positions that offer the flexibility to work from anywhere. In my experience, remote positions can provide a better work-life balance, which is an important consideration for many professionals today.

Additionally, I’ve found that remote work often requires strong communication and self-discipline. Developing these skills can help you thrive in a remote marketing strategy career, allowing you to excel regardless of your location.
